In general, a computer appliance is a computing device with a specific function and limited configuration ability, and a software appliance is a set of computer programs that might be combined with just enough operating system (JeOS) for it to run optimally on industry standard computer hardware or in a virtual machine.

A firewall appliance is a combination of a firewall software and an operating system that is purposely built to run a firewall system on a dedicated hardware or virtual machine. These include:

  • embedded firewalls: very limited-capability programs running on a low-power CPU system,
  • software-based firewall appliances: a system that can be run in independent hardware or in a virtualised environment as a virtual appliance
  • hardware-based firewall appliances: a firewall appliance that runs on a hardware specifically built to install as a network device, providing enough network interfaces and CPU to serve a wide range of purposes. From protecting a small network (a few network ports and few megabits per second throughput) to protecting an enterprise-level network (tens of network ports and gigabits per second throughput).

Firewall software

Some firewall solutions are provided as software solutions that run on general purpose operating systems. The following table lists different firewall software that can be installed / configured in different general purpose operating systems.

 
Firewall  License  Cost and usage limits  OS
Avast Internet Security Proprietary Paid Microsoft Windows
Comodo Internet Security Proprietary Free Windows 10/8.1/8/7/Vista x32/x64, XPx32
Intego VirusBarrier Proprietary Paid Mac OS X 10.5 or later; on an Xserve
Kaspersky Internet Security Proprietary Paid / 30 day trial Windows unknown versions x32/x64
Lavasoft Personal Firewall Proprietary Paid Windows unknown versions x32/x64
Microsoft Forefront Threat Management Gateway Proprietary Discontinued Windows unknown versions x64
NetLimiter Proprietary Paid Windows 10, 8, 7 x64
Norton 360 Proprietary Paid Windows unknown versions x32/x64
Online Armor
Personal Firewall Proprietary Discontinued Windows unknown versions x32/x64
Outpost
Firewall Pro Proprietary Discontinued Windows 10, 8, 7, Vista, XP x32/x64
PC Tools
Firewall Plus Proprietary Discontinued Windows unknown versions x32/x64
Sygate
Personal Firewall Proprietary Discontinued Windows unknown versions x32
Windows Firewall Proprietary Included with Windows
XP SP2 and later ALL Windows Versions x32/x64
ZoneAlarm Proprietary Free / Paid Windows 7 / Vista / XP SP3/ Windows 8, 8.1. 10 x32/x64
Netfilter/iptables GPL Free Linux kernel module
nftables GPL Free Linux kernel (>=3.13) module
Shorewall GPL Free Linux-based appliance
PeerBlock GPL Free Windows 8/8.1, 7, Vista x32/64
NPF BSD Free NetBSD kernel module
PF BSD Free *BSD kernel module
ipfirewall BSD Free *BSD package
IPFilter GPLv2 Free Package for multiple UNIX-like operating systems
